Brain Tumor Treatment Centers

UPMC Hillman Cancer Center

Brain, Spinal, and Nervous System Cancer Treatment Program

5150 Centre Avenue,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, 15232, United States

Additional Information:

This program meets 7/7 of the Guiding Principles for CNS Tumor Treatment Programs.

Awards/Certifications:

  • American College of Radiation Oncology Practice Accreditation
  • Quality Oncology Practice Initiative Certification
  • Nationally ranked in cancer care by U.S. News & World Report

Data for this program collected in 2023.

Accreditations:

  • National Cancer Institute Designation: Yes
  • Nurse Magnet Status: Yes
  • Academic Affiliation: University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ine

Number of Full-Time Physicians:

Number of full-time physicians in this treatment program who dedicate at least 40% of their clinical practice to the treatment of adult patients diagnosed with brain and/or spine tumors:
  • 4 Neuro-oncologists or Medical Oncologists specializing in brain/spine tumors
  • 5 Brain Neurosurgeons
  • 3 Spine Neurosurgeons
  • 4 Radiation Oncologists
  • 3 Neuropathologists

Number of Adult Patients Treated for Brain and/or Spine Tumors Annually:

  • >300 Primary tumor patients
  • >300 Metastatic (Secondary) tumor patients

Number of Adult Patients Treated with Surgery Annually:

  • ~150 Primary brain tumor patients
  • ~150 Metastatic (Secondary) brain tumor patients
  • ~100 Primary spine tumor patients
  • ~50 Metastatic (Secondary) spine tumor patients
  • ~100 Skull base tumor patients
